Yankees OF Garder has MRI, confirms bone bruise
TAMPA, Fla. (AP) Yankees left fielder Brett Gardner had an MRI on Thursday that confirmed he has a bone bruise in his right wrist.
Gardner was hit by a pitch Monday and left the game mid-way through New York's win over Baltimore. He missed the next two games with soreness in the wrist, but hopes to play Friday at Tampa Bay.
